CARLTON midfielder Heath Scotland has been charged with recklessly causing injury following an incident in May last year.
Scotland is co-operating with authorities during the investigation into the matter.
No details of the incident have been released and Carlton is refusing to comment any further.
"The matter will now follow the appropriate course," a spokesman said.
Scotland, 25, is a former Collingwood star who played in the Magpies' 2002-03 grand finals.
He played 53 games for Collingwood from 1999-2003 before being traded to Carlton.
Scotland last August re-signed with the Blues for a further two years.
